Calcium has become the most promoted nutrient by proponents of conventional, nutritional, and alternative medicine - yet at the same time, the assumed need is based purely on the speculation that the body's dietary calcium intake is well below its requirements. Since a patient's calcium status cannot be established through routine blood tests, guidelines - including for postmenopausal women - continue to follow the same standard recommendations, regardless of individual variations in calcium absorption or requirements...
